INTC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2026 in Review

3,545 of the 8,278 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Intel (INTC) for Q2 2026, worth a combined $486B — up 228% from $148B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 1,123 funds opened new INTC positions and 113 closed out — a net gain of 1,010 holders — while 1,005 added to existing stakes and 1,163 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Fidelity Investments, adding an estimated $3.73B. The largest seller was Capital World Investors, cutting an estimated $2.49B.
